Medical Education at Necmettin Erbakan University
Currently, the medical faculty at Necmettin Erbakan University conducts all its courses and assessments in the Turkish language. The university's curriculum is designed to be entirely immersive in Turkish, providing students with a comprehensive understanding of medical principles and practices through the Turkish language.
Language Proficiency Requirements
The vast majority of classes, clinical rotations, and academic requirements at Necmettin Erbakan University are conducted in Turkish. Professors and patients alike communicate exclusively in Turkish. Therefore, students must demonstrate a high level of proficiency in the language to succeed in their medical studies.
For non-Turkish speakers, enrolling in the medical program at Necmettin Erbakan University is not feasible without a strong command of the Turkish language. The university may provide Turkish language courses as a preparatory step, but these do not guarantee admission to the medical program.
Requirements for Applying to the Medical Program
To be considered for admission, international students must have completed at least one year of intensive Turkish language study. This one-year period serves to familiarize students with the Turkish language and culture, making it possible for them to engage effectively in medical education.
